<title>arm: mvebu: Add RD-AC5X board</title>
<updated>2022-11-07T06:46:28+00:00</updated>
<author>
<name>Chris Packham</name>
<email>judge.packham@gmail.com</email>
</author>
<published>2022-11-05T04:24:00+00:00</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=6cc8b5db40b4d5fc23086a5116bdf1f0a3d3265a'/>
<id>6cc8b5db40b4d5fc23086a5116bdf1f0a3d3265a</id>
<content type='text'>
The RD-AC5X-32G16HVG6HLG-A0 development board main components and
features include:
* Main 12V/54V power supply
* 270 Gbps throughput packet processor on the main board
* DDR4:
  * SR1: 2GB DDR4 2400MT/S(1GB x 2 pcs ) with ECC(1GB x 1 pcs)
  * SR2: 4GB DDR4 2400MT/S(2GB x 2 pcs ) with ECC(2GB x 1 pcs)
  * PCB co-layout with 4GB device to support 8GB (Dual CS) requirement
* 16GB eMMC (Samsung KLMAG1JETD-B041006)
* 16MB SPI NOR(GD25Q127C)
* 32 x 1000 Base-T interfaces
* 16 x 2500 Base-T interfaces
  * SR1: 88E2540*4
  * SR2: 88E2580*1+88E2540*2
* Six (6) x 25G Base-R SFP28 interfaces
* One (1) x RJ-45 console connector, interfacing to the on board UART
* One (1) x USB Type-A connector, interfacing to the USB 2.0 port (0)
* One (1) x USB Type-mini B connector, interfacing to the USB 2.0 port (1)
* One (1) x RJ-45 1G Base-T Management port, interfacing to the host
  port (shared with PCIe) Connected to 88E1512 Gigabit Ethernet Phy
* One (1) x Oculink port, interfacing to the PCIe port for external CPU
  connection
* POE 802.3AT support on Port 1 ~ Port 32, 802.3BT support on Port 33 ~
  Port 48 (Microsemi PD69208T4, PD69208M or TI TPS2388,TPS23881
  solution)
* POE total power budget 780W
* LED interfaces per network port/POE
* LED interfaces (common) showing system status
* PTP TC mode Supported (Reserved M.2 connector to support BC mode)

<title>highbank: switch to use the Arm SP804 DM_TIMER driver</title>
<updated>2022-11-02T17:58:17+00:00</updated>
<author>
<name>Andre Przywara</name>
<email>andre.przywara@arm.com</email>
</author>
<published>2022-10-20T22:10:25+00:00</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=44b7abf8dc953f935d1de067cdace9dae2cbfb3c'/>
<id>44b7abf8dc953f935d1de067cdace9dae2cbfb3c</id>
<content type='text'>
So far the Calxeda machines were using the CONFIG_SYS_TIMER_* macros to
simply hardcode the address of the counter register of the SP804 timer.
This method is deprecated and scheduled for removal.

Use the newly introduced SP804 DM_TIMER driver to provide timer
functionality on Highbank and Midway machines. The base address and base
frequency are taken from the devicetree.

<title>cyclic: get rid of cyclic_init()</title>
<updated>2022-11-02T07:42:03+00:00</updated>
<author>
<name>Rasmus Villemoes</name>
<email>rasmus.villemoes@prevas.dk</email>
</author>
<published>2022-10-28T11:50:54+00:00</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=50128aeb0f8bb5a2d820e4c7a6ac0bb745809fc1'/>
<id>50128aeb0f8bb5a2d820e4c7a6ac0bb745809fc1</id>
<content type='text'>
Currently, we must call cyclic_init() at some point before
cyclic_register() becomes possible. That turns out to be somewhat
awkward, especially with SPL, and has resulted in a watchdog callback
not being registered, thus causing the board to prematurely reset.

We already rely on gd-&gt;cyclic reliably being set to NULL by the asm
code that clears all of gd. Now that the cyclic list is a hlist, and
thus an empty list is represented by a NULL head pointer, and struct
cyclic_drv has no other members, we can just as well drop a level of
indirection and put the hlist_head directly in struct
global_data. This doesn't increase the size of struct global_data,
gets rid of an early malloc(), and generates slightly smaller code.

But primarily, this avoids having to call cyclic_init() early; the cyclic
infrastructure is simply ready to register callbacks as soon as we
enter C code.

We can still end up with schedule() being called from asm very early,
so we still need to check that gd itself has been properly initialized
[*], but once it has, gd-&gt;cyclic_list is perfectly fine to access, and
will just be an empty list.

As for cyclic_uninit(), it was never really the opposite of
cyclic_init() since it didn't free the struct cyclic_drv nor set
gd-&gt;cyclic to NULL. Rename it to cyclic_unregister_all() and use that
in test/, and also insert a call at the end of the board_init_f
sequence so that gd-&gt;cyclic_list is a fresh empty list before we enter
board_init_r().

A small piece of ugliness is that I had to add a cast in
cyclic_get_list() to silence a "discards 'volatile' qualifier"
warning, but that is completely equivalent to the existing handling of
the uclass_root_s list_head member.

[*] I'm not really sure where we guarantee that the register used for
gd contains 0 until it gets explicitly initialized, but that must be
the case, otherwise testing gd for being NULL would not make much sense.

<title>cyclic: switch to using hlist instead of list</title>
<updated>2022-11-02T07:41:55+00:00</updated>
<author>
<name>Rasmus Villemoes</name>
<email>rasmus.villemoes@prevas.dk</email>
</author>
<published>2022-10-28T11:50:53+00:00</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=28968394839bec37dacf6ffc2ae880e38756e917'/>
<id>28968394839bec37dacf6ffc2ae880e38756e917</id>
<content type='text'>
A hlist is headed by just a single pointer, so can only be traversed
forwards, and insertions can only happen at the head (or before/after
an existing list member). But each list node still consists of two
pointers, so arbitrary elements can still be removed in O(1).

This is precisely what we need for the cyclic_list - we never need to
traverse it backwards, and the order the callbacks appear in the list
should really not matter.

One advantage, and the main reason for doing this switch, is that an
empty list is represented by a NULL head pointer, so unlike a
list_head, it does not need separate C code to initialize - a
memset(,0,) of the containing structure is sufficient.

This is mostly mechanical:

- The iterators are updated with an h prefix, and the type of the
  temporary variable changed to struct hlist_node*.

- Adding/removing is now just hlist_add_head (and not tail) and
  hlist_del().

- struct members and function return values updated.
